You’ve all heard of The Vault Dweller, the man sent into the wasteland in search of a water chip, and through doing so, changed the world. But what exactly did he go through? If not for The Vault Dwellers' Memoirs we wouldn’t know and the many stories from those he met would have no doubt been embellished and clouded the truth, fortunately we don’t have to think about that and can instead read what he wanted us to know.
